Additional Opportunities
Podcast Guest – Share your personal or professional insights on brain tumour-related topics to educate and inspire our community.
Webinar Guest – Participate in educational webinars to provide information, guidance, and support for those affected by brain tumours.
Content Creation – Help develop engaging videos, posters, and digital media to spread awareness and support our initiatives.
Photography – Capture meaningful moments at events to help share the impact of our work and community stories.
Health Care Professional Partner – Use your expertise to help spread awareness and improve our reach within the brain tumour community.
Administrative Support – Ideal for volunteers in London, Ontario, who want to provide in-office administrative support and assist with daily operations.
